Cidera provides a managed global Internet broadcast platform which improves the delivery of rich media. Cidera operates the world's largest distributed Internet content delivery platform, spanning 500 different data networks, and broadcasting to more than 10,000 enterprise locations in North America North America, third largest continent (1990 est. pop. 365,000,000), c.9,400,000 sq mi (24,346,000 sq km), the northern of the two continents of the Western Hemisphere. and Europe. The company serves content service providers, as well as broadband and dialup Internet access providers, offering superior quality and lower cost distribution for Web content, streaming media See streaming audio, streaming video and digital media hub. , and large databases.
